Transaction d21cce64a5e8b7fe41f10961891548dd3f5d8028070186bbb601affa908fdde8

3 Input
2 Outputs
  • d21cce64a5e8b7fe41f10961891548dd3f5d8028070186bbb601affa908fdde8:0
  • value  138113
    address  34XhhAhR9kYuGo4xZ1ae85dsYaSWRe8Prs
  • d21cce64a5e8b7fe41f10961891548dd3f5d8028070186bbb601affa908fdde8:1
  • value  1006166
    address  1F5LT41MeworestAbBRdeinE6EwYPouNVG